Castle's "SA flag" campaign
I tend to have my ear to the ground on most things concerning advertising and PR, but didn't hear a peep about this fantastic flag until I saw the ad. Even then I just thought it was an ad, until I saw the flag fly past one of the stadiums. I have friends who saw it at the stadium and they just thought it was a really messed up, low budget flag being flown past. Maybe I just wasn't in the right shopping centre or something, but they could have gotten a lot more fabric (mileage) out of this one. What happened? Great idea, bad execution? Of course there will be those of you who will say the boring old stuff like "Well, you are talking about it now aren't you?" True, but I could have been talking about it 2 months ago and then seeing the thing on TV and knowing what the hell it was.
